| Parameter | Value |
|---|---|
| NSN | 5910-00-256-9829 |
| Primary Part Number | MILR39014-1 |
| Item Name | Capacitor,fixed,ceramic Dielectr |
| FSC / FSG | 5910 / 59 — No Item Name Available |
| Manufacturer | Military Specifications Promulgated by Military Departments/agencies Under Authority of Defense Standardization Manual 4120 3-M |
| Status | ACTIVE |
| Reliability Indicator | ESTABLISHED |
| Capacitance Value Per Section | 56.000 PICOFARADS SINGLE SECTION |
| Material | PLASTIC CASE |
| Terminal Surface Treatment | SOLDER |
| Dissipation Factor at Reference Temp in Percent | 2.5000 |
| Insulation Resistance at Reference Temp | 100000.0 MEGOHMS |
| Center to Center Distance Between Terminals Parallel to Length | 0.200 INCHES NOMINAL IN |
| Tolerance Range Per Section | -10.00 TO 10.00 PERCENT SINGLE SECTION |
| Body Style | W/O MTG FACILITIES TERMINAL(S) ON ONE SURFACE |
| Terminal Length | 1.250 INCHES MINIMUM IN |
| Body Height | 0.090 INCHES NOMINAL IN |
| Insulation Resistance at Maximum Operating Temp | 10000.0 MEGOHMS |
| Test Data Document | 81349-MILC39014/1 SPECIFICATION (INCLUDES ENGINEERING TYPE BULLETINS, BROCHURES,ETC., THAT REFLECT SPECIFICATION TYPE DATA IN SPECIFICATION FORMAT; EXCLUDES COMMERCIAL CATALOGS, INDUSTRY DIRECTORIES, AND SIMILAR TRADE PUBLICATIONS, REFLECTING GENERAL TYPE DATA ON CERTAIN ENVIRONMENTAL AND PERFORMANCE REQUIREMENTS AND TEST CONDITIONS THAT ARE SHOWN AS "TYPICAL", "AVERAGE", "NOMINAL", ETC.). |
| Voltage Temp Limits Per Section in Percent Capacitance Change | -15.0 TO 15.0 WITHOUT VOLTAGE APPLIED SINGLE SECTION |
| Nonderated Operating Temp | -55.0 CELSIUS MINIMUM AND 125.0 CELSIUS MAXIMUM DEGC |
| Nonderated Continuous Voltage Rating and Type Per Section | 200.0 DC SINGLE SECTION |
| Schematic Diagram Designator | NO COMMON OR GROUNDED ELECTRODE(S) |
| Terminal Type and Quantity | 2 UNINSULATED WIRE LEAD |
| Body Width | 0.190 INCHES NOMINAL IN |
| Body Length | 0.190 INCHES NOMINAL IN |
| Acquisition Status | ACTIVE |
| HAZMAT | No |
